The global 12 Inch (300mm) Chemical Mechanical Polishing (CMP) Equipment Market is witnessing robust expansion, driven by the rising demand for advanced semiconductors across electronics, automotive, and industrial sectors. As semiconductor nodes shrink and integration density increases, precision planarization has become critical, propelling the adoption of CMP equipment tailored for 300mm wafer processing.

Chemical Mechanical Polishing (CMP) is a pivotal step in semiconductor fabrication, ensuring defect-free surfaces and precise layer alignment. With the increasing complexity of integrated circuits, CMP equipment has evolved to meet high-volume manufacturing demands while maintaining surface integrity at nanoscale levels. The transition to 12-inch (300mm) wafers enables higher throughput and cost-efficiency, further fueling market growth.

Key Drivers Accelerating Market Growth

The expansion of the 12 Inch CMP equipment market is being driven by several key factors:

  • Rising Demand for Smaller Node Chips: Devices using 5nm and below technologies require precise planarization, increasing the reliance on advanced CMP tools.

  • Expansion of Foundry and Memory Manufacturing Facilities: Global investments in fabs are boosting equipment installations for 300mm wafer processing.

  • Increased Use in Emerging Technologies: CMP plays a critical role in enabling 3D NAND, FinFET, and logic applications, all of which rely on flawless interlayer performance.

These drivers collectively strengthen the market’s growth outlook and create long-term value.

Market Opportunities in Automation and Advanced Materials

As the semiconductor industry continues to scale, several opportunities are emerging for innovation in CMP equipment:

  • Integration of AI and Machine Learning: Smart CMP tools can self-adjust polishing parameters, improving yield and reducing downtime.

  • Advanced Slurry and Pad Materials: Innovations in consumables are enhancing polishing uniformity, reducing defects, and extending equipment lifespan.

  • Adoption of Fully Automated CMP Platforms: The need for faster wafer throughput and reduced manual intervention is driving demand for turnkey automation solutions.

These opportunities are setting the stage for next-generation CMP systems capable of supporting ultra-high-density chip production.


Restraints and Challenges Affecting Market Growth

Despite the promising outlook, the market faces a few critical challenges:

  • High Capital Investment: CMP systems are among the most expensive tools in a fab, which can limit adoption among smaller manufacturers.

  • Process Complexity and Yield Sensitivity: Improper planarization can result in costly defects, requiring continuous process refinement and operator expertise.

  • Dependence on Semiconductor Market Cycles: Fluctuating demand in end-use sectors can directly affect equipment procurement trends.

Addressing these restraints requires a focus on cost-efficiency, innovation, and resilience across supply chains.

Emerging Trends Shaping Market Evolution

Recent technological and strategic trends are reshaping the CMP equipment landscape:

  • Rise of Heterogeneous Integration: Advanced packaging technologies like chiplets and interposers are expanding CMP use cases.

  • Environmental and Energy Efficiency Initiatives: Equipment with lower water and slurry usage is gaining popularity amid sustainability concerns.

  • Digital Twin and Predictive Maintenance Integration: Real-time monitoring of tool performance is reducing downtime and improving fab efficiency.

These developments are key indicators of where the market is heading and how CMP will evolve in the semiconductor value chain.
